Adeyinka Afolabi Emerges Cybersecurity Personality of the Year at Achievers Awards International.

Adeyinka Lukman Afolabi has been named the Cybersecurity Personality of the Year at the just-concluded Achievers Awards International, a global recognition platform that celebrates exceptional contributors across Africa and beyond.

This year’s award ceremonies were held at the prestigious Golden Tulip Hotel in Zanzibar, Tanzania, followed by a concluding dinner and recognition night in Nigeria for Nigeria. awardees unable to attend the main event.
